No it's not - Maybe I've not worded things correctly when asking King things (that's my fault) Since the editor does not create new maps just a Copy of another map will not work as intended in the game - in map editor bring up "Map Properties" for the copy of the map you are using (Say it's Leurik's Basement for example) Now look at the "MAP ID" and it says 25_basement
now unless you edit that ID name - when you Save your game after being in your new basement you have created it will save as 25_basement even if your map is called "35_inncellar.map".

It still works though. For instance, I copied "35_cellar.map" and renamed it "Bernie.map" And then opened "Bernie.map" and changed the Description from "A Dank Cellar" to "A Smelly Cellar." Then I made the Stairs Link on "35.map" call for "Bernie" instead of "35_Cellar" and sure enough, when I loaded the save and walked down the stairs, I was in "A Smelly Cellar" instead of "A Dank Cellar" even though the 35_Cellar.map was sill in the save folder. Apparently it's just another title header... maybe it's something linked to the .ent files... but as long as you have the map name in the folder, and link it properly it will load as many files as you want.

I did try opening the map file in notepad and changing the title designation that way, but then the map editor won't recognize the map... *shrug*
